Smart Contract Security Advancements

Architecture

Smart contract security advancements increasingly focus on modular design and formal verification within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ives. Layered architectures, separating critical logic from peripheral functions, limit the blast radius of potential exploits. Employing provably correct code through formal methods, such as model checking and theorem proving, enhances assurance, particularly vital for complex derivative contracts. This shift towards robust architectural patterns and rigorous verification processes is essential for maintaining trust and mitigating systemic risk in decentralized financial systems.
